



Description:
AD9954 DDS Signal Generator is a direct digital frequency synthesizer (DDS), using the latest technology, built-in a high-speed high-performance DAC, form a complete digital programmable, high-frequency synthesizer, can produce up to 150MHz frequency agile analog output sine wave.
400MHz DDS Signal Source Is can achieve fast frequency hopping, and also has precise frequency tuning (0.01Hz or higher resolution) and phase harmonics (0.022 ° interval), the standard program is adjustable 1hz. If users need higher precision, they need to change the program by themselves. Can be programmed through a high-speed serial I / O port.
The device's built-in static RAM supports flexible frequency sweep functions in multiple modes and supports user- defines linear scan modes; At the same time, an on-chip high-speed comparator is built in, suitable for applications requiring square wave output. With the help of the on-chip oscillator and PLL circuit, users can create the system clock of the device in various ways.
Specifications:
- Module model: AD9954
- Module type: digital synthesis frequency source
- Power supply module: DC-5V
- Module current: 100mA (MAX); quiescent current 48mA (TYPE) normal stick current 92mA (TYPE)
- Communication protocol module: SPI serial
- Module offers routines: STM32F103RCT6
- Routine platform: STM32F103X-M3 KEIL5 version source code
- Module system main frequency: 400MHz (MAX)
- DAC resolution digits: 14 digits
- Phase accumulator bits: 32 bits
- Module output interface: SMA; 24 hour salt spray anti-oxidation
- Output impedance: 75 ohms
Features:
- Module output signals: sine wave, square wave; sine wave with 150MHz low-pass filter. Square shaft coupling output.
- Module output channel: 2 channel differential; phase difference is 180 degrees, high-frequency output will have phase shift due to filter
- The signal characteristics of the module: the sine wave has no coupling output; the output has its own DC component. When you are connected to the radio frequency equipment, please add a DC block, or you can directly use an oscilloscope to measure
- Highest main frequency output sine signal range: 1Hz-140MHz
- Maximum main frequency output square wave signal range: 1Hz-120MHz 10MHz or more requires an oscilloscope input impedance of 50 ohms
- Output amplitude: sine wave 200mVpp (MAX) square wave 3.3 Vpp; sine wave amplitude decreases with increasing frequency, square wave waveform changes with increasing frequency
- Module features: several; high-performance DDS sine signal generator, high-order elliptical filter,
- Low noise regulator chip, etc.
